Description

Crowmarsh Battle Farmhouse is a farmhouse, probably built in the mid-18th century, with some alterations made in the 19th century. It has a rendered exterior, likely over brick, and features a hipped roof made of Welsh slate with brick chimney stacks. The building has an L-shaped plan and stands two storeys high with a four-window range.

There is a central 20th-century porch that has a gabled roof and a panelled half-glazed door. To the left, there is a two-storey angled bay window with sash windows. A 16-pane sash window is located to the right of the center and on the left return of the cross-wing to the right. There is also a 20th-century metal casement window at the end of the cross-wing. Additionally, a 16-pane sash window is situated between the ground and first floors to the left of the center, with another 16-pane sash on the first floor to the right of the center and on the left return of the cross-wing. The building has end stacks on the left and at the end of the cross-wing.

At the rear, the structure is made of coursed limestone rubble with brick dressings, featuring 19th-century window arrangements on the ground floor. The first floor has 16-pane unhorned sash windows, except for a 12-pane sash on the left. The interior has not been inspected. This farmhouse is part of a notable group of farm buildings.
